Abstract(in English) | Streaming data from IoT devices can be regarded as Information Flow, and new services are expected to distribute Information Flow by Edge Computing technology. We develop a control method to distribute Information Flow efficiently through Device to Device (D2D) offloading. When user service request changes frequently, D2D communication using the existing multicast routing protocol increases unnecessary streaming data duplication and consequently decreases communication efficiency. In this paper, we design a protocol of D2D Information Flow control, which determines communication passes based on service context and then avoids unnecessary streaming data duplication for unevenly-distributed groups of different service requests. Moreover, we evaluate performance of proposed protocol through discrete event simulations. |
